This course explores the drivers and dynamics of modern corporate communications and its relationship with marketing and public relations. You focus on stakeholder management, global marketing, brand management, reputation management, media relations and social media. You will understand the knowledge, skills and approaches that enable you to balance the often conflicting demands of an organisation's stakeholders and deliver clear, consistent communications to all parties. Taught by staff with extensive research and consultancy expertise, you will develop knowledge and skills that are directly relevant to the workplace. You will also have the opportunity to undertake a project that will involve working on a consultancy issue with academic staff and company mentors. A number of senior figures from the world of corporate communications, marketing and public relations are invited to deliver guest lectures, providing a practitioner's view of the latest industry developments.
